Snowy Hydro 2.0 power station creates thousands of new jobs across NSW


THE Prime Minister’s “game-changing” Snowy Hydro 2.0 power station will create 5000 new jobs across NSW when construction starts next year. Mr Turnbull, who will visit the Snowy Hydro power station in Cooma this morning, told The Daily Telegraph 5000 new jobs would be created in Cooma, Tumut and Sydney in a “jobs bonanza” when construction begins. media_camera Mr Turnbull will this morning fly to Cooma before catching a helicopter to a Snowy Hydro site. Already, 350 people have been employed in the construction of Snowy Hydro 2.0, with extensive drilling, soil-testing and analysis work being done on the western side of the Tumut mountains. media_camera The numbers behind the Snowy Hydro scheme.
